Jaguar launches project for car to travel at supersonic speed




Jaguar said Thursday that it launched a project called “Bloodhound Supersonic Car Project” to develop a car that can run at supersonic speed.

The company said it will try to break the world record for the fastest car, which can go 440 kilometers per hour (275.9 miles per hour), by next year and will try to reach 1,000 miles per hour by 2016. A V8 super charger engine from Jaguar’s AWD F-Type R Coupe sports car with 550 horsepower will be used in the Bloodhound SCC.
